Driving directions from Songjiang, China to Tehran, Iran distance


Songjiang, China
Tehran, Iran
Songjiang to Tehran road map

Songjiang to Tehran flight distance miles / km

4,000.1 mi / 6,437.6 km
Also see in China
Of interest in Iran